Dune circle is a beautiful street and as the years go by it stands out as one of the more popular Beachside streets on which to live.  More than just a single lane running from Kalaheo Avenue to the Beach, Dune Circle as developed into a tight community.  There is a private beach access point for those that live off of the beach. This is also a great section of the beach and as the seasons change and the beach widens and narrows, year after year, Dune Circle retains a fair amount of its beach width.  The surf is fairly gentle in front of this lane.

Two of the Kailua homes that are for sale on the beach have a long history on the beach.  Both 350 and 376 Dune Circle were built in the 1950’s when brick building was prevalent along Beachside.  As the years go by, it is becoming harder and harder to find these treasures.  Brick is an obvious choice for the Hawaii climate.  It does a better job keeping the house cool and termites are less of a worry.

This wonderful piece of Real Estate also has a famous history. This was the home of Mr. and Mrs. Hargreaves. They were prolific authors of books on Hawaii’s trees and plants at a time when not much was being written about them. Their books were on flowers and trees in Hawaii, the Pacific, and the Caribbean. Their treasured books can still be found at the Kailua Library.
